How to prepare for a job interview at Hollybank Trustees Ltd
✨Know Your Processes
As a Process Operator, it's crucial to understand the specific processes used in production. Brush up on the techniques and machinery relevant to the role. Familiarise yourself with common challenges in the supply chain sector and be ready to discuss how you would handle them.
✨Show Your Team Spirit
Collaboration is key in production environments. Be prepared to share examples of how you've worked effectively in a team. Highlight your communication skills and how you contribute to a positive work atmosphere, as this will resonate well with the interviewers.
✨Ask Smart Questions
Interviews are a two-way street! Prepare thoughtful questions about the company's production processes, safety protocols, or team dynamics. This shows your genuine interest in the role and helps you assess if the company is the right fit for you.
✨Dress for Success
Even though the role is on-site, first impressions matter. Dress appropriately for the interview, leaning towards smart-casual. This demonstrates professionalism and respect for the opportunity, setting a positive tone from the get-go.
